Peter's beautiful 26 year old youngtimer is not just a car; it is a beautiful example of automotive beauty, equipped with a Zender body kit that gives it an unmistakable allure. The bumpers, in the color of the body with a black rubber strip, and the beautiful nose that is reminiscent of the Alfa 156, emphasize the aesthetic finesse of this classic. Under the hood we find the familiar Twin Spark petrol engine. Although Peters Alfa 145 is equipped with a 2.0-litre engine, this range was also available with 1.4, 1.6 and 1.8 engines.
The bright red color of the car suggests speed, even when the car is stationary. This suggestion is reinforced by an adjustment of the power source to 170/180 hp, which makes this Alfa 145 holds its own on the circuit. The car is not only equipped with impressive technology; the exhaust produces the unique Alfa screech as soon as you press the accelerator.
Circuit days and the Circuit Meppen
Peter's life is inextricably linked to the circuit. He works in organizing track days and manages Circuit Meppen in Germany. This passion for the racing world has its origins in Peter's youth, as evidenced by the family album in which a one-year-old Peter behind the wheel of a Alfa Berlina sits.
Symbol of luck
The real love for Alfa Romeo was created when Peter bought his first car at the age of 20: a dark blue one Alfa Romeo 145 with a 1.6 engine and a Zender body kit. This car has always remained dear to him, which makes it logical that, for nostalgic reasons, he now drives a 145 again, complete with Zender body kit and the four-leaf clover (Quadrifoglio Verde) as a symbol of luck.
The hall of fame
In Peter's warehouse you can sense the strong image of Alfa Romeo. Various models are on display, from driveable examples to project cars. Below this hall of fame are located next to the Alfa 145, a few Alfa GTV 6's, two Bertone's in GTA (replica) version, one Alfa 33-16V and a Alfa 75 in racing version with a 200 hp Twin Spark engine.
